Angelique’s daughter is incapable of self-care because of cancer, a disability, and she … WebNov 1, 1995 · Some FMLA "serious health conditions" may be ADA disabilities, for example, most cancers and serious strokes. Other "serious health conditions" may not be ADA disabilities, for example, pregnancy or a routine broken leg or hernia.

WebAn FMLA serious health condition generally involves a period of incapacity. Incapacity means an individual is unable to work, attend school, or perform other regular daily … WebFact Sheet #28: The Family and Medical Leave Act of 1993.
